Lines Matching defs:PhysicalDeviceRayTracingPipelineFeaturesKHR

80775   struct PhysicalDeviceRayTracingPipelineFeaturesKHR  struct
80777 using NativeType = VkPhysicalDeviceRayTracingPipelineFeaturesKHR;
80779 static const bool allowDuplicate = false;
80780 …NSTEXPR StructureType structureType = StructureType::ePhysicalDeviceRayTracingPipelineFeaturesKHR;
80783 …ONSTEXPR PhysicalDeviceRayTracingPipelineFeaturesKHR( VULKAN_HPP_NAMESPACE::Bool32 rayTracingPipel… in PhysicalDeviceRayTracingPipelineFeaturesKHR() argument
80800PhysicalDeviceRayTracingPipelineFeaturesKHR( VkPhysicalDeviceRayTracingPipelineFeaturesKHR const &… in PhysicalDeviceRayTracingPipelineFeaturesKHR() function
80810 …*this = *reinterpret_cast<VULKAN_HPP_NAMESPACE::PhysicalDeviceRayTracingPipelineFeaturesKHR const … in operator =()
80815 …EXPR_14 PhysicalDeviceRayTracingPipelineFeaturesKHR & setPNext( void * pNext_ ) VULKAN_HPP_NOEXCEPT in setPNext()
80822 setRayTracingPipeline( VULKAN_HPP_NAMESPACE::Bool32 rayTracingPipeline_ ) VULKAN_HPP_NOEXCEPT in setRayTracingPipeline()
80829 …ULKAN_HPP_NAMESPACE::Bool32 rayTracingPipelineShaderGroupHandleCaptureReplay_ ) VULKAN_HPP_NOEXCEPT in setRayTracingPipelineShaderGroupHandleCaptureReplay()
80835 …icalDeviceRayTracingPipelineFeaturesKHR & setRayTracingPipelineShaderGroupHandleCaptureReplayMixed( in setRayTracingPipelineShaderGroupHandleCaptureReplayMixed()
80843 …ysIndirect( VULKAN_HPP_NAMESPACE::Bool32 rayTracingPipelineTraceRaysIndirect_ ) VULKAN_HPP_NOEXCEPT in setRayTracingPipelineTraceRaysIndirect()
80850 …lPrimitiveCulling( VULKAN_HPP_NAMESPACE::Bool32 rayTraversalPrimitiveCulling_ ) VULKAN_HPP_NOEXCEPT in setRayTraversalPrimitiveCulling()
80857 operator VkPhysicalDeviceRayTracingPipelineFeaturesKHR const &() const VULKAN_HPP_NOEXCEPT in operator VkPhysicalDeviceRayTracingPipelineFeaturesKHR const&()
80862 operator VkPhysicalDeviceRayTracingPipelineFeaturesKHR &() VULKAN_HPP_NOEXCEPT in operator VkPhysicalDeviceRayTracingPipelineFeaturesKHR&()
80879 reflect() const VULKAN_HPP_NOEXCEPT in reflect()
80894 …ool operator==( PhysicalDeviceRayTracingPipelineFeaturesKHR const & rhs ) const VULKAN_HPP_NOEXCEPT in operator ==()
80907 …ool operator!=( PhysicalDeviceRayTracingPipelineFeaturesKHR const & rhs ) const VULKAN_HPP_NOEXCEPT in operator !=()
80914 … = StructureType::ePhysicalDeviceRayTracingPipelineFeaturesKHR;
80915 void * pNext = {};
80916 VULKAN_HPP_NAMESPACE::Bool32 rayTracingPipeline = {};
80917 VULKAN_HPP_NAMESPACE::Bool32 rayTracingPipelineShaderGroupHandleCaptureReplay = {};
80918 VULKAN_HPP_NAMESPACE::Bool32 rayTracingPipelineShaderGroupHandleCaptureReplayMixed = {};
80919 VULKAN_HPP_NAMESPACE::Bool32 rayTracingPipelineTraceRaysIndirect = {};
80920 VULKAN_HPP_NAMESPACE::Bool32 rayTraversalPrimitiveCulling = {};